La loi ecarte tout soupcon de conflit d'interet en prescrivant au juge de s'abstenir a priori de juger dans les cas ou celui-ci pourrait avoir un interet personnel, une affection ou une inimitie a l'egard des personnes ou de l'objet du proces selon le canon 1448. Si les officiers qui doivent s'abstenir pour les motifs stipules dans le canon 1448 ne le font pas, la partie peut les recuser. Si la recusation est admise, d'autres personnes non suspectes sont nommees mais le tribunal et le degre de juridiction restent les memes. Les actes accomplis par le juge avant qu'il ne soit recuse sont valides. Ceux qui ont ete realises apres la requete en recusation mais avant son acceptation sont rescindables si la partie en fait la demande dans les dix jours qui suivent l'acceptation de la recusation. Les actes accomplis par le juge entre la proposition et l'admission de la recusation sont valides.
